WebJul 8, 2024 · Twill is a style of textile weaving where the weft thread is woven over and under one or more warp threads, creating a closely woven fabric with a diagonal rib pattern. … WebDec 9, 2024 · The name ‘twill’ describes a specific type of weave that creates a diagonal or diamond pattern in the fabric. Not all fabric called ‘twill’ is made from the same types of material. Twill can be woven from a range of materials such as cotton, polyester, silk and wool. Twill is most often used to create harder-wearing textiles.
WebConclusion. Twill fabric is a broad term applied to any kind of cloth woven in a twill pattern. A twill weave has a distinctive pattern of diagonal lines made with raised ridges of thread. Twill fabric can contain many different kinds of material, including cotton, polyester, or wool. http://heftstich.net/
